What is 32-bit and 64-bit in computer?

The terms 32-bit and 64-bit refer to the way a computer’s processor (also called a CPU), handles information. The 64-bit version of Windows handles large amounts of random access memory (RAM) more effectively than a 32-bit system.

Windows operating systems come in two main versions: 32-bit and 64-bit. The main difference between these two versions is the amount of memory (RAM) that each can utilize. 32-bit versions of Windows can only address up to 4GB of RAM, while 64-bit versions of Windows are capable of addressing up to 16TB of RAM. It’s important to note that 32-bit versions of Windows are limited to only accessing 4GB of RAM, regardless of how much RAM is installed in the computer. This can be a major drawback for users who need to use a large amount of memory in their applications.

How do I know if my computer is 32 or 64-bit?

How can I tell whether Windows on my computer is running in 32- or 64-bit mode?

  1. Select Settings > System > About after clicking the Start button. Open About settings.
  2. At the right, under Device specifications, see System type.

What is 32 and 64-bit called?

A common abbreviation for 32-bit hardware and software is x86 or x86-32. Common names for 64-bit hardware and software include x64 and x86-64. May 16, 2022.

Is 64-bit or 32 better?

When running multiple programs simultaneously and switching between them frequently, a 64-bit system may be more responsive because it can handle large amounts of memory more effectively than a 32-bit operating system in these circumstances.
